Directional Couplers

Facilitate signal monitoring and sampling without disrupting the main path—critical for power measurements and network analysis.

Attenuators (Fixed & Digital)

Precisely manage signal amplitude in test benches and automated setups—available in broad attenuation ranges and step resolutions.

RF Adapters & Connectors

Ensure low-loss, high-reliability connections between test instruments, fixtures, and DUTs (Devices Under Test).

RF Filters

Control frequency behavior and eliminate unwanted noise or spurious signals during testing and evaluation.

Wilkinson and Reactive Power Dividers

Deliver balanced signal splitting with excellent port-to-port isolation and phase matching—ideal for multi-channel testing.

DC Blocks

Isolate DC voltages while allowing clean RF signal transmission—ideal for protecting sensitive instrumentation during signal path analysis.
